#ea1058 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ea1058 is composed of 91.8% red, 6.3%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.2%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 340.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 49%. #ea1058 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20b0 with #d50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

Shades and Tints of #ea1058

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0105 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ea1058

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807a7c is the less saturated color, while #f40655 is the most saturated one.
